The Art of Tasseomancy: Basics Workshop!

13/02/2013 19:02

Learn to See What’s in Your Tea! Amy will be presenting a workshop about Tasseomancy or better known as Tea Leaf Reading. Learn the history of tea, tea reading and what teas are best for readings. Discover the nuances of teapots, teacups & saucers and their significance in the Tasseomancers process. Learn how to brew a proper cup of tea for a reading and how to set the mood for the inquirer. This workshop is taught with much interaction and hands-on experiences. Handouts and actual readings are included.

Amy Taylor:
With 25 years experience as a professional Tea Leaf Reader and Tea Enthusiast, Amy teaches various workshops about tea and tasseomancy (tea leaf reading). She also reads tea leaves professionally, does private tea reading parties, unique tea tasting parties and can be available for private functions, business functions, public and special events. With her many years of tea and tea reading experience, Amy realized that she had a lot to offer the public and she decided to take her tea, tea reading workshops and tea reading ability to the public in a much more easily accessible form. She has now been teaching many of her workshops for over 10 years.

Amy has also been featured in articles for Now! Magazine (Toronto 1996), What's On Queen Magazine (2001) Ki Awareness Magazine (2010) and nationally acclaimed Maclean's Magazine (2012) and Tea Magazine (2012). She also has been interviewed on CBC radio (2006), various podcasts (2005 - ongoing) and video interviewed (2011) for Nadia Shah Productions. More recently (Jan 2013) she interviewed for the podcast radio show Steeping Around (part of American Food Network Radio) about Tasseomancy which is a 3 part show.
